# Sifter Search — Environments

Heads up, reviewers: relevance tuning diverges per environment on purpose. Staging runs the experimental synonym expansion and heavier phrase boosting; prod stays conservative until the Marrowgate eval suite signs off. Please don't "align" them in a PR without checking with the ranking crew first. The current per-environment tuning values are below.

config for tawif-bagef:
[sorwyn]
team = sorys
access_code = ac_9ba40c
host = sorwyn.ordingrid.local
port = 5000
owner = aldok.quenion
peer = belath.paliqcloud.local

Team,

As covered in the sync, Lanternhook now hot-reloads config, so this quarter's key rotation needs no restarts. Drop the new value into the shared config bundle and the watcher picks it up within thirty seconds. Old keys die Friday. The replacement credential for the Lanternhook internal API follows below.

API key for yahig-tadup: kto7_ubizbYm

Subject: Partner SFTP drop — new owner

Hi,

As you review the pending changes to the Harborline ingest scripts, note that ownership of the partner SFTP drop is changing at the end of the month. This includes key rotation, the nightly pull job, and the quarantine folder for malformed files. Review comments on the retry logic should still go through the normal PR flow, but questions about drop-folder conventions or partner onboarding now go to the new owner. The incoming owner is listed below.

signatory, tagaf-bahaf: Praael Fenmir Rusok

**Q: How does the weather-alert fan-out actually work?**

Short version: when Stormlark receives a severe-weather notice, it fans the alert out to every subscriber in the affected region within about ninety seconds. If a customer says they got duplicates, that's usually a retry after a slow push receipt — annoying but harmless. If they got nothing at all, check their region mapping first. The full troubleshooting flow for fan-out issues lives on the page below.

runbook for badug-kadup: https://confluence.zemvarlabs.internal/projects/browse/display/projects/bd1b